From f55ef056b246021dce386bf140101fd5bb51221d Mon Sep 17 00:00:00 2001 From: Neil South Date: Thu, 25 Jul 2024 12:56:30 +0100 Subject: [PATCH] tests fixup? Signed-off-by: Neil South --- src/Api/Storage/Payload.cs | 2 ++ .../Repositories/MonaiServiceLocator.cs | 3 +-- tests/Integration.Test/Drivers/EfDataProvider.cs | 9 ++++++++- 3 files changed, 11 insertions(+), 3 deletions(-) mode change 100644 => 100755 tests/Integration.Test/Drivers/EfDataProvider.cs diff --git a/src/Api/Storage/Payload.cs b/src/Api/Storage/Payload.cs index 46115f63e..cccb148ec 100755 --- a/src/Api/Storage/Payload.cs +++ b/src/Api/Storage/Payload.cs @@ -86,6 +86,8 @@ public TimeSpan Elapsed public int FilesFailedToUpload { get => Files.Count(p => p.IsUploadFailed); } + public Payload() { } + public Payload(string key, string correlationId, string? workflowInstanceId, string? taskId, DataOrigin dataTrigger, uint timeout) { Guard.Against.NullOrWhiteSpace(key, nameof(key)); diff --git a/src/InformaticsGateway/Repositories/MonaiServiceLocator.cs b/src/InformaticsGateway/Repositories/MonaiServiceLocator.cs index 4fab79749..3fd78bfc2 100755 --- a/src/InformaticsGateway/Repositories/MonaiServiceLocator.cs +++ b/src/InformaticsGateway/Repositories/MonaiServiceLocator.cs @@ -57,8 +57,7 @@ public Dictionary GetServiceStatus() if (TypeInterface is null) { var service = _serviceProvider.GetServices()?.FirstOrDefault(i => i.GetType().Name == type.Name); - return null; - //return service as IMonaiService; + return service as IMonaiService; } return (_serviceProvider.GetService(TypeInterface) as IMonaiService); diff --git a/tests/Integration.Test/Drivers/EfDataProvider.cs b/tests/Integration.Test/Drivers/EfDataProvider.cs old mode 100644 new mode 100755 index cda1b3b47..63b0bbb15 --- a/tests/Integration.Test/Drivers/EfDataProvider.cs +++ b/tests/Integration.Test/Drivers/EfDataProvider.cs @@ -62,7 +62,14 @@ public void ClearAllData() DumpAndClear("SourceApplicationEntities", _dbContext.SourceApplicationEntities.ToList()); DumpAndClear("MonaiApplicationEntities", _dbContext.MonaiApplicationEntities.ToList()); DumpAndClear("VirtualApplicationEntities", _dbContext.VirtualApplicationEntities.ToList()); - DumpAndClear("Payloads", _dbContext.Payloads.ToList()); + try + { + DumpAndClear("Payloads", _dbContext.Payloads.ToList()); + } + catch (Exception) + { + } + DumpAndClear("InferenceRequests", _dbContext.InferenceRequests.ToList()); DumpAndClear("StorageMetadataWrapperEntities", _dbContext.StorageMetadataWrapperEntities.ToList()); _dbContext.SaveChanges();